The album's lead single, "Wake Me Up", featuring Aloe Blacc, set the tone for "True". This genre-bending track combined soulful vocals with driving EDM beats and lush instrumentation. The song's massive success, peaking at number one in several countries, established Avicii as a force to be reckoned with in the music industry.
The critical and commercial success of "True" was unprecedented. The album debuted at number one on the US Billboard 200 chart, making Avicii the first EDM artist to achieve this feat. The album received widespread critical acclaim, with many praising Avicii's innovative production, eclecticism, and emotional depth. The idea for "True" took shape in 2012, when Avicii began working on a series of tracks that would eventually form the album. He drew inspiration from various genres, incorporating traditional Swedish folk music, reggae, and country elements into his productions. Avicii's journey to creating "True" began several years prior to its release. Born in Stockholm, Sweden, Tim Bergling started producing music at the age of 16, under the influence of EDM and hip-hop. He gained initial recognition on online platforms, such as MySpace and YouTube, where he shared his early productions. By 2011, Avicii was already making waves in the EDM scene, performing at prominent festivals and collaborating with notable artists.
The impact of "True" on the music industry and EDM scene cannot be overstated. Avicii's fusion of genres and experimentation with new sounds inspired a generation of producers and DJs. The album's success paved the way for future EDM artists to explore diverse styles and collaborate with artists from other genres.
